Solution

The correct option is A Velocity at point D is greater than that at point B
The slope of the displacement - time graph at a point gives us the velocity at that point. From the graph, it is clear that the slope at point D is greater than that at point B. Hence the velocity at point D is greater than that at point B. So, option (A) is correct.
